Transaction d1bfa71104fdd545a29c0c8d07e300b1730f55a4d24a285d232a44e7b8b0f775
1 Input
1 Output
-
d1bfa71104fdd545a29c0c8d07e300b1730f55a4d24a285d232a44e7b8b0f775:0
- value
- 1578487
- script pubkey
- OP_0 OP_PUSHBYTES_20 f054d7440a99875a882cfd33e000a1cd34c2402c
- address
- bc1q7p2dw3q2nxr44zpvl5e7qq9pe56vyspvhc8dk2